Fujitsu LifeBook S7211Fujitsu Computer Systems has announced the LifeBook S7211 14-inch notebook, aimed at cost-conscious small and medium size business customers.

The Fujitsu LifeBook S7211 starts at $899 and features the Intel Pentium Dual-Core Processor T2330 at 1.6 GHz or the Intel Core 2 Duo T5250 CPU at 1.5 GHz, depending on model. The notebook is based on the Intel GM965 chipset with the Graphics Media Accelerator X3100. This integrated GPU manages the S7211’s 14.1″ Crystal View widescreen display with a 1280-by-800 pixels resolution. The laptop features 1GB of DDR2 system memory, expandable to 4GB, a 120GB hard drive at 5,400rpm, and a modular bay, that fits an optical drive, an additional battery for up to 6.5 hours of run time, or a weight-saver.

Regarding networking and communications, the LifeBook S7211 incorporates the Atheros 802.11a/b/g LAN module, a Gigabit Ethernet connection, a 56k modem, and an optional Bluetooth.

It also has a built-in 1.3-megapixel web camera, three USB ports, an ExpressCard slot, a 3-in-1 media card reader, and a VGA output.

The laptop weighs approximately 5.2 pounds with an optical drive.

The Fujitsu LifeBook S7211 comes with Windows Vista Business or Windows XP Professional preinstalled and is available through the Fujitsu’s online store.
